Exercising after EON (Endovenous Laser Treatment) in Houston is a common concern among patients seeking to enhance their vascular health. EON is a minimally invasive procedure used to treat varicose veins, and it is essential to follow specific guidelines to ensure optimal recovery and results.
Immediately after the procedure, it is advisable to avoid strenuous activities for the first few days. Light walking is generally encouraged as it promotes circulation and aids in the healing process. However, more intense exercises like weightlifting or high-impact activities should be avoided for at least two weeks post-treatment. This precaution helps prevent complications such as bleeding or vein inflammation.
Consulting with your healthcare provider in Houston is crucial to receive personalized advice tailored to your specific condition and treatment. They can provide detailed guidelines on when it is safe to resume your regular exercise routine. Following these recommendations ensures that you heal properly and reduces the risk of any post-treatment issues.
In summary, while light exercises can be beneficial post-EON, it is important to avoid strenuous activities for a couple of weeks and to seek professional advice to ensure a smooth recovery process.
